Peach Cobbler
Peach Cobbler is a delicious and classic dessert that combines the sweet, juicy flavour of peaches with a deliciously buttery and tender crust, creating a comforting treat that’s perfect for any occasion.
70 min
Easy
4-6
Recipe Ingredients
Ingredients for the Filling
- 6-8 peaches, peeled, pitted, and sliced
- 200 grams caster sugar
- ½ teaspoon ground cinnamon
- 1-2 teaspoons lemon juice
- 1 tablespoon cornstarch
Ingredients for the Batter
- 125 grams plain flour
- 200 grams caster sugar
- 2 teaspoons baking powder
- ¼ teaspoon salt
- 240 millilitres milk, at room temperature
- 110 grams unsalted butter, melted
- butter for greasing the casserole
Methods
1. Preheat the Oven
Preheat the oven to 190°C (375°F) and lightly grease a casserole.
2. Prepare the Filling
Start by peeling, pitting, and slicing the peaches. I used vineyard peaches, but any other variety of peaches will work.
Place the sliced peaches in a mixing bowl. Add 200 grams of caster sugar, ½ teaspoon of ground cinnamon, 1-2 teaspoons of lemon juice, and 1 tablespoon of cornstarch.
Stir gently and let sit for 10-15 minutes to allow the flavours to meld and the peaches to release some of their juice.
3. Prepare the Batter
In a separate mixing bowl, combine 125 grams of plain flour, 200 grams of caster sugar, 2 teaspoons of baking powder, and ¼ teaspoon of salt. Mix well.
Pour 240 millilitres of milk and 110 grams of melted butter into the dry ingredients and stir briefly. It’s okay if small lumps remain. Avoid over-mixing to prevent a dense texture.
4. Assemble the Cobbler
Pour the batter into the prepared casserole, spreading it evenly. Spoon the peach mixture evenly over the batter, including the juice. Do not stir! The batter will rise around the peaches as it bakes, creating a delicious crust.
5. Bake
Transfer the casserole to the preheated oven and bake for 40-45 minutes, or until the top is golden brown and the dough has risen around the peaches.
Once baked, allow the Peach Cobbler to cool slightly before serving.
6. Serve
Peach Cobbler is best served warm, either on its own or with a scoop of vanilla ice cream. The contrast between the warm cobbler and the cold ice cream is a delicious treat. Drizzle some caramel sauce on top for extra indulgence.
Variations
Berry-Peach Cobbler: Add a handful of mixed berries (like blueberries, blackberries, or raspberries) to the peach mixture for a fruity twist.
Almond Peach Cobbler: Add ½ teaspoon of almond extract to the batter and sprinkle sliced almonds on top before baking.
Whole Wheat Peach Cobbler: Substitute half of the plain flour with whole wheat flour for a heartier texture.
Maple Peach Cobbler: Replace the caster sugar in the filling with 120 millilitres of maple syrup for a reacher flavour.
